Stuart Fails to Save the Universe finally has a face, a date and a full cast. HBO Max dropped the first official teaser on May 13, 2026, and the new spinoff puts Kevin Sussman back in the comic book store as Stuart Bloom, with three more Big Bang Theory alums pulled into the same alternate reality mess. Per the breakdown filed at TVLine and the trailer posted to the official HBO Max YouTube channel, Stuart Fails to Save the Universe is a Chuck Lorre project, and he is calling it a science fiction action and adventure comedy.
Premiere lands on July 23, 2026, and there will be weekly drops after that. Stuart is the center of a multiverse story now, which is a sentence almost nobody saw coming.
Who plays Stuart Bloom in Stuart Fails to Save the Universe?
The headline name on Stuart Fails to Save the Universe is Kevin Sussman, who carried Stuart Bloom across all twelve seasons of The Big Bang Theory as the comic store owner with the worst luck in Pasadena. He is the lead this time, and the trailer leans into how strange that sentence still sounds.
Three other The Big Bang Theory veterans signed on. Brian Posehn is back as Bert Kibbler, the geologist with rocks and a dry voice. Lauren Lapkus returns as Denise, the comic store employee who became the rare grown adult to actually date Stuart on the original show.
The fourth name carries the biggest twist. John Ross Bowie is back as Barry Kripke, but the trailer also bills him as Supreme Ruler Barry Kripke, the alternate version from another reality stream. Deadline first reported the casting in February 2025, and the dual role looks like the centre of attention of the whole multiverse premise. Kevin Sussman is also playing more than one Stuart on the show, per the first official synopsis.
Stuart Fails to Save the Universe new cast addition
Ryan Cartwright, the guy Bones and Alphas fans will recognize on sight, plays someone called Kyle. Silicon Valley alum Josh Brener is in there as Trevor. Tommy Walker rounds out the trio as Gary, the role nobody seems to have any details on at all. How any of them plug into Stuart, the comic book store, or the multiverse plot the trailer keeps teasing, we have no idea about that yet.
The behind the scenes roster on Stuart Fails to Save the Universe is just as loaded. Danny Elfman wrote the theme music. Jonathan Frakes, the Star Trek: The Next Generation veteran, is on board as a director on multiple episodes. Star Trek: Voyager veteran Robert Duncan McNeill is also directing. Both names confirm what Chuck Lorre told People in February 2026 about wanting to push past his couch comedy comfort zone. The series is being made by Chuck Lorre Productions with Warner Bros. When does Stuart Fails to Save the Universe premiere on HBO Max?
Mark the date! Stuart Fails to Save the Universe premieres on HBO Max on July 23, 2026, and there will be weekly releases after that. The plot, going by what Chuck Lorre told People, is a science fiction action and adventure comedy. He admitted he wanted something that made him uncomfortable, since most of his career has been people sitting on a couch and talking. The teaser shows Stuart somehow ending up at the center of a multiverse crisis with the fate of every reality stream resting on him.
Stuart Fails to Save the Universe is the fourth show in The Big Bang Theory franchise, after the original sitcom,Young Sheldon and the Georgie and Mandy spinoff. The filming was done from September 2025 through February 2026, and the teaser came out on May 13, 2026.
